bowse (verb) haul with a tackle Synonyms: bouse
browse (noun) the act of feeding by continual nibbling Synonyms: browsing
(noun) reading superficially or at random Synonyms: browsing
(noun) vegetation (such as young shoots, twigs, and leaves) that is suitable for animals to eat
(verb) eat lightly, try different dishes Synonyms: graze
(verb) look around casually and randomly, without seeking anything in particular Synonyms: surf
(verb) feed as in a meadow or pasture Synonyms: crop, graze, pasture, range
(verb) shop around; not necessarily buying Synonyms: shop
dowse (noun) searching for underground water or minerals by using a dowsing rod Synonyms: dowsing, rhabdomancy
(verb) cover with liquid; pour liquid onto Synonyms: douse, drench, soak, sop, souse
(verb) slacken Synonyms: douse
(verb) use a divining rod in search of underground water or metal
(verb) wet thoroughly Synonyms: douse
drowse (noun) a light fitful sleep Synonyms: doze
(verb) be on the verge of sleeping
(verb) sleep lightly or for a short period of time Synonyms: doze, snooze
hawse (noun) the hole that an anchor rope passes through Synonyms: hawsehole, hawsepipe
tawse (noun) a leather strap for punishing children
